Fundraiser Show for Toby's Gender Affirming Care:
Mabel Clarke are a Folk-emo-rock-jam band, fronted by Suzie Nicholls. The songs are earnest and blunt but with a through-line of catchy silliness in the orchestration, typically devolving into chaos. “A sprawling and immersive collection” lullaby’s become doom, parochial repetition gains a noisy urgency. Darlings of the DIY scene.
Bug are a heavy psychedelic noise rock band from Brighton getting together every now and then to make some noise together. With 2 EPs already out they have some releases on the way for your listening enjoyment.
ABE - Brighton-based experimental rock three-piece a basic fault weaves prog and psychedelic influences into a power trio format, creating a live performance that embodies the ethos of their recordings: a fluid, uninterrupted, and dynamic experience.
AnKnee - Singer-songwriter blend of alternative country folk - big voice, big cries.
Limbslacker - Limbslacker are new Southern sadcore with second wave inspiration, outbursting lyrics fuelled by honesty, entangled with anger. estranged melancholic sounds from sinew. Elliott Smith meets JeJune.
